Abstract
The embodiment of the invention provides a bandwidth controlling method, device, terminal and system based on videoconference; the method comprises the steps that: the conference control apparatus respectively establishes call connection with the circuit network terminal and packet switched network terminal; the conference control apparatus ensures that the packet switched network bandwidth does not satisfy the packet switched network video data transmission request and notifies the circuit network terminal to execute code stream controlling, thereby reducing the circuit network video data transmission speed. The technical proposal provided by the embodiment of the invention, when judging that the packet switched network bandwidth does not satisfy the packet switched network video data transmission request, notifies the circuit network terminal to execute code stream controlling, which solves the problem of losing packet in videoconference mixed by circuit network terminal and packet switched network, and stably reduces the speed in the videoconference mixed by circuit network terminal and packet switched network and strengthens the network suitability and improves the ease of use of mixed networking.

Background technology
Video conferencing system can be applicable to circuit-switched network or packet network, but when above-mentioned two kinds of mixture of networks are used, has a lot of problems, the situation that for example exists packet loss and bandwidth to ensure.H.320 the video conferencing system universal standard based on circuit network is, H.320 standard comprises series of standards for its service, and H.221/H.242/H.239 example waits; H.323 the video conferencing system universal standard based on packet network is, H.323 standard comprises series of standards for its service, and H.245/Q.931/H.239 example waits.
During H.320 with mixing application H.323, system need dispose H.320 or H.323 gateway support mixing application, the effect of gateway be exactly conversion H.320 and signaling H.323 and medium packing manner.
As shown in Figure 1; Multipoint control unit (MCU:Multipoint Control Unit) is connected with terminal H.320 through circuit network (SDH:Synchronous Digital Hierarchy or ISDN:Integrated Services Digital Network) in the video conferencing system of circuit network and IP network mixing application, and is connected with terminal H.323 through IP network.Wherein as MCU and when H.323 the bandwidth between the terminal can not reach the demand bandwidth; Need terminal reduction of speed H.323 to be handled through the flow-control command in the agreement H.245; But because MCU and H.320 the bandwidth between the terminal be secure, so agreement does not support to connect the code stream reduction of speed after the foundation, when terminal reduction of speed H.323; H.320 the terminal transmitted stream surpasses the code stream that terminal H.323 can be accepted, and causing H.323, the terminal produces image flower screen because of the code stream packet loss.
In order to address the above problem, the prior art H.320 code stream of gateway is issued H.323 terminal again through after the adaptation processing, ensures H.323 normally receiving media code stream of terminal, makes H.323 the terminal can not spend screen.In realizing process of the present invention, the inventor finds that this solution of carrying out code stream conversion (transcoding) with adaptive mode has consumed more cpu resource, has increased cost, and has caused the image effect variation.
In order to address the above problem, prior art also realizes the reduction of speed processing of ISDN meeting-place through the B channel mode of hanging up ISDN.In realizing process of the present invention, the inventor finds that this scheme only is applicable to the terminal that integrated services digital network (ISDN:Integrated Service Digital Network) inserts, and is inapplicable for the terminal of access via telephone line, the bandwidth that uncontrollable E1 inserts.

Embodiment three
The embodiment of the invention provides a kind of band width control method based on video conference.In the embodiment of the invention, be example as conference control equipment, but the conference control equipment of the embodiment of the invention comprise and is not limited to MCU that the conference control equipment that any and MCU have identical or identity function all can be used to substitute MCU with MCU.The circuit network terminal includes but not limited to H.320 terminal, can also be ISDN terminal, the PSTN terminal, and the packet network terminal includes but not limited to H.323 terminal, can also be sip terminal.
On the basis of embodiment two, after the circuit network terminal received conference control equipment transmitted stream control notice, it was to realize with the mode of filling the invalid video Frame that code stream control is carried out at the circuit network terminal.
H.320 the code stream of terminal before carrying out coded video bit stream is as shown in Figure 4, and wherein A representes audio frequency (Audio); V representes video (Video); F representes frame alignment word (FAS:Frame Alignment Signal); B bit stream assignment signalling (Bit-rate Alignment Signal).If channel width is 128K, and audio frequency takies 48K, and video takies the channel width except that FAS, BAS and Audio.Behind call setup, H221 time slot table is fixing, and it is fixing promptly to look audio bandwidth, if when the actual audio code stream can not satisfy the 48K bandwidth, needs to replenish quiet code stream; When if the actual video code stream can not satisfy respective bandwidth, then need fill the invalid video Frame, for example forward error correction (FEC:Forward Error Correction) infilled frame.
As shown in Figure 5, the band width control method based on video conference of the embodiment of the invention may further comprise the steps: MCU convenes and contains H.323 terminal and the H.320 meeting at terminal, promptly MCU respectively with terminal H.323, H.320 terminal connect (step S501); H.323 the terminal detects Network Packet Loss, to MCU feedback packet loss, perhaps sends Flow Control message to MCU, also can realize (step S502) according to user's needs oneself; MCU is according to the packet loss or the Flow Control bandwidth calculation network bandwidth, sends Flow Control message (step S503) to terminal H.323 simultaneously; H.323 code stream is sent according to the Flow Control bandwidth of MCU in the terminal, realizes H.323 terminal reduction of speed (step S504); H.323 behind the reduction of speed of terminal, MCU sends flow-control command (step S505) to terminal H.320; H.320 after flow-control command is received at the terminal, carry out code stream control (step S506) with the mode of filling the invalid video code stream; Simultaneously the MCU side begins to detect from video data frame (step S507) in the video code flow at terminal H.320; When transmitting code stream, video data frame is removed, to reach the video code flow bandwidth (step S508) that terminal H.323 can receive.
Realized steady reduction of speed through above step.
According to above-mentioned steps S506, the code stream figure behind the filling video infilled frame (fec frame) is as shown in Figure 6.Wherein A representes: audio frequency (audio); V representes: video (video); F representes: frame alignment word (FAS:Frame Alignment Signal); B representes: bit stream assignment signalling (Bit-rate Alignment Signal); D representes: video data frame.
After the above-mentioned steps S508 end, if MCU and the H.323 improvement of the network between the terminal for example detect less than packet loss in continuous a period of time behind the reduction of speed, the MCU transmitting control commands, the Flow Control of cancellation forwarding code stream limits and realizes the raising speed processing.Said control command realizes that through expansion MBE (multibyte expansion) message form is { Start_MBE}/N/ < x >/(N-1) bytes.Wherein { Start_MBE} is MBE; The MBE message identifier, N is the MBE message-length, < x>is the MBE information order, can use 0xCF, the information order that MBE reserves.As shown in Figure 7, be the MBE information order table that provides of inventive embodiments.N in Fig. 7: be fixed as 4 at present, can change during other parameters of subsequent expansion; Media channel sign: 1 video main flow, the auxilliary stream of 2 videos; The target bandwidth: with K is unit; Example: 768K fills out 0300 (16 system).
Realize the stable reduction of speed in the video conference that switching network uses with through above step, further, after network takes a turn for the better, realized the raising speed processing.
The embodiment of the invention is carried out code stream control through in the video conference that circuit-switched network and packet network are used with, using the infilled frame mode; Solved the problem of packet loss in the video conference; Realized the stable reduction of speed in the video conference that circuit-switched network and packet network are used with; Strengthen network-adaptive property, improved the ease for use of mixed networking.
Embodiment four
The embodiment of the invention provides a kind of band width control method based on video conference.In the embodiment of the invention, be example as conference control equipment, but the conference control equipment of the embodiment of the invention comprise and is not limited to MCU that the conference control equipment that any and MCU have identical or identity function all can be used to substitute MCU with MCU.The circuit network terminal includes but not limited to H.320 terminal, can also be ISDN terminal, the PSTN terminal, and the packet network terminal includes but not limited to H.323 terminal, can also be sip terminal.
On the basis of embodiment two, after the circuit network terminal received conference control equipment transmitted stream control notice, it was to realize with the mode of changing the time slot table that code stream control is carried out at the circuit network terminal.
As shown in Figure 8, the band width control method based on video conference of the embodiment of the invention may further comprise the steps: MCU convenes and contains H.323 terminal and the H.320 meeting (step 8801) at terminal; H.323 the terminal detects Network Packet Loss, to MCU feedback packet loss, perhaps sends Flow Control message to MCU, perhaps can realize according to user's needs oneself) (step S802); MCU according to packet loss or Flow Control bandwidth calculation current network bandwidth as, send Flow Control message (step S803) to terminal H.323 simultaneously; H.323 code stream is sent according to the Flow Control bandwidth of MCU in the terminal, realizes H.323 terminal reduction of speed (step S804); H.323 behind the reduction of speed of terminal, MCU sends flow-control command (step S805) to terminal H.320; H.320 after flow-control command is received at the terminal, the video sub-slots (step S806) that MCU reduces according to Flow Control bandwidth calculation needs; H.320 the terminal is then according to Flow Control bandwidth encode (step S807); H.320 the time slot table (step S808) of local terminal is upgraded at the terminal simultaneously.Like Fig. 9 black partly is exactly the sub-slots that reduces, and when transmitted image, can not use the sub-slots of these two black.
MCU need to upgrade the H.320 time slot table at terminal of local terminal correspondence, otherwise video code flow can not be resolved normally after H.320 flow-control command is sent at the terminal; After MCU upgrades local terminal time slot table, need send the request of I frame, avoid because the change of time slot table causes image flower screen to terminal B.

Embodiment five
The embodiment of the invention provides a kind of band width control method based on video conference.In the embodiment of the invention, be example as conference control equipment, but the conference control equipment of the embodiment of the invention comprise and is not limited to MCU that the conference control equipment that any and MCU have identical or identity function all can be used to substitute MCU with MCU.The circuit network terminal includes but not limited to H.320 terminal, can also be ISDN terminal, the PSTN terminal, and the packet network terminal includes but not limited to H.323 terminal, can also be sip terminal.
On the basis of embodiment two, after the circuit network terminal received conference control equipment transmitted stream control notice, it was that mode with active channel realizes that code stream control is carried out at the circuit network terminal.
The H221 frame can be made up of multiple channel mode, and the passage order is shown in figure 10, and various passages can be selected to use according to user's practical application.The passage of present embodiment is auxilliary circulation road.
Auxilliary circulation road control protocol is following:
AMC-open<AMCOpenByte1><AMCOpenByte2>
< AMCOpenByte1 >: described auxilliary stream application roles and channel number
< AMCOpenByte2 >: having described auxilliary circulation road bandwidth, is unit with 8K (sub-slots)
AMC-close<AMCCloseByte1>
< AMCCloseByte1 >: described auxilliary circulation road label
Auxilliary circulation road is supported dynamic opening and is closed in agreement, can reach the purpose of reduction of speed through this protocol application.
Shown in figure 11 is the flow chart of the mixing meeting broadband control method that provides of the embodiment of the invention; The MCU control desk passes through MCU and convenes and contain H.323 terminal and the H.320 meeting at terminal (step S1101); H.323 the terminal detects Network Packet Loss, to MCU feedback packet loss, perhaps sends Flow Control message to MCU, perhaps can realize (step S1102) according to user's needs oneself; MCU is according to packet loss or Flow Control bandwidth calculation current network bandwidth such as 768K, sends Flow Control message (step S1103) to terminal H.323 simultaneously; H.323 code stream is sent according to the Flow Control bandwidth of MCU in the terminal, realizes H.323 terminal reduction of speed (step S1104); H.323 behind the reduction of speed of terminal, MCU calculates the timeslot number (step S1105) that terminal H.320 needs reduction of speed; MCU sends auxilliary circulation road to terminal H.320 and opens control command (step S1106); H.320 after the terminal receives that auxilliary circulation road is opened order, according to Flow Control bandwidth encode (step S1107); H.320 the terminal need be changed the time slot table of local terminal simultaneously, increases the time slot (step S1108) of auxilliary stream in the time slot table; MCU needs to upgrade the time slot table of local terminal after H.320 transmission auxilliary circulation road in terminal is opened, the time slot of the auxilliary stream of increase is accomplished reduction of speed (step S1109) in the same time slot table.Preferably, above-mentioned steps also comprises: if detect behind the reduction of speed less than packet loss, then limit through the Flow Control of cancelling the forwarding code stream and realize the raising speed processing.
Because auxilliary circulation road just is used for the main flow reduction of speed in the present embodiment, the data in the therefore auxilliary circulation road only need be given tacit consent to filling, do not need to resolve.The foregoing description is the example explanation with auxilliary circulation road just, in like manner is suitable for but present embodiment is not limited to the passage that auxilliary circulation road takies other.
